stuartg wrote:
What medical tests are required for ARC?

Do you require a liver function test?

Are there drug tests done via a blood or urine sample?


I had all of these done at the hospital. They never even showed me the results, although I'm sure I could request them.

You will have to give a urine sample and you will have blood drawn.

You'll also do an eye exam, and take standard measurements like blood pressure, weight, height and dental.

You pay for your own airfare and are reimbursed about 3-4 weeks later. Also, the "settlement fee" doesn't get paid to you until this same time, so you will need some money for food/internet connection etc.

yeah you buy your own ticket for public schools, but if you want to get reimbursed as soon as possible go to the hospital the day after you arrive and get the medical check done. that way you can get the results back and turn them into immigration, then get your ARC. after you get your ARC you can get a bank account and you can get paid. so quickest way to do it is go to the hospital the day you arrive or the day after. just have the required tests written down in korean and hand it to someone at the hospital, they will send you in the right direction.
